GDPR Cookie Notice has one disclosed vulnerability in the WordSec catalog, all reported in 2025; it remains unpatched as of September 2026. Their average CVSS score is 5.3, and the most serious one scores 5.3 out of 10.
The most common weakness is Missing Authorization, behind 1 of the records (100%).
The one issue recorded for GDPR Cookie Notice has no published fix yet, which makes virtual patching the only reliable mitigation. The oldest unresolved one dates back to 2025.
All of these findings were reported by Kévin Mosbahi (Mika). GDPR Cookie Notice is installed on roughly 100 WordPress sites, so each unpatched flaw has a wide blast radius. The current release is tested up to WordPress 5.7.17.

The GDPR Cookie Notice plugin will assist you in making your website GDPR compliant. Show cookie notice to your site easily. More customization features coming. Contact US https://www.themeqx.com/contact-us/ Key Features GDPR Cookie Notice will enable a notice with Accept options. The cookies are not rendered by default and only upon user consent. By default, if any users accept the cookie, it will set a cookie for 30 days to users browser. Admin can configure cookie details and their description from the backend. This cookie notice plugin able to show a Privacy policy Page to notice, so anyone can click and read your websites privacy policy. Admin can set Predefined Privacy Policy page from the Settings > GDPR Cookie Notice page Extremely Light Weight
